Mortgage REITs. Mortgage REITs (sometimes referred to as “mREITs”) originate loans and mortgages and lend money to real estate developers. They make money primarily from the interest earned ...Senior Housing Fundamentals. From a high level, attractive SH fundamentals are a three part equation: –. 1. Demand: The 80+ year old population is growing at the quickest pace in U.S. history. Since 2010, the growth rate has been around 1.7%, but looking forward estimates project a CAGR of 4.4%.This birthed the Senior Housing Operating (SHO) structure, where the REIT pays the manager a fee to operate the facility rather than charging rent. Figure 4 highlights the major differences, but most importantly, SHO allows the REIT to share in the operational upside at their properties.
